How to uninstall Host App Service from your system

This info is about Host App Service for Windows. Here you can find details on how to uninstall it from your computer. It is produced by Pokki. More information about Pokki can be found here. Host App Service is usually installed in the C:\UserNames\epoadmin\AppData\Local\Pokki directory, regulated by the user's option. The full command line for uninstalling Host App Service is C:\UserNames\epoadmin\AppData\Local\Pokki\Uninstall.exe. Keep in mind that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you might be prompted for admin rights. The application's main executable file has a size of 7.45 MB (7807816 bytes) on disk and is titled HostAppService.exe.

Host App Service is comprised of the following executables which occupy 19.93 MB (20901936 bytes) on disk:

  • Uninstall.exe (1.75 MB)
  • HostAppService.exe (7.45 MB)
  • HostAppServiceUpdater.exe (8.85 MB)
  • StartMenuIndexer.exe (1.82 MB)
  • wow_helper.exe (65.50 KB)
